By virtue of its design, and its different material options, they
might be used for potable water or raw water.
Before installation, check the configuration of the material in
order to control the compatibility of the hydrant with the fluid
that is going to flow both inside and in the external environment.
If used with technically clean fluids (e.g. drinking water,
depending on allowable operating pressure) flow speeds up to 4
m/s are allowed in permanent conditions of use (see table 2 for
limits), when the wedge is in fully opened position.
In case of fire protection use, maximum flow rate should not
exceed 1.5 times the Kv-value for cavitation safety reason.
Temperature of the medium shall not exceed max. 50°C (see
table 3 for limits).

Installation conditions can be outdoors, buried in the ground, in
a valves' room.
All deviating operating instructions and deviating fields of
application are subject to the manufacturer's approval.
As we do not have any control or prior knowledge of the quality
and properties of the water, we recommend the installation of
our hydrant with enamel coating when the water tends to form
deposits or encrustations.
2.5 Unacceptable operation
Do not use the shut-off cone of the hydrant in an intermediate
position to restrict water flow. Continuous operation in a flow-
restricting position can cause cavitation and major wear of the
products that will lead to leakage and malfunctions. This type of
underground fire hydrants is suitable only for "OPEN-CLOSED"
operation.
Negative pressure levels (cavitation) are to be avoided at all costs.
Extending the operating elements, e.g. with levers or similar
devices is not allowed.
Do not exceed temperature limits for the flow media.
Do not exceed permisable operating pressure. The closed valve
may only be loaded up to the allowable operating pressure.
For the version with the cone fully encapsulated in EPDM, the
EPDM parts must not be allowed to come into contact with
any medium containing oil or grease, as EPDM swells in those
circumstances.

Whatever the materials that constitute it, it is absolutely
forbidden to use our underground fire hydrants with gaseous
fluids such as propane, butane, natural gas or with hydrocarbon
fluids like petrol, diesel, etc.

2.6 Marking
The following information is cast into the body:
• Manufacturer name
• DN
• PN
• Cast material
• Installation depth RD
The following information is cast into the bonnet:
• Total number of turns for closing or opening
• DN
• PN
• European standard EN14339
The following information is shown on additional labels:
• Name of the range
• Product number
• Drilling type, if special or different than PN
• Approvals (if any)
• Date of manufacturing
In addition to standard marking and factory labels, each hydrant
is delivered with a corrosion resistant identity disc, located under
the operating square cap, in order to give easy acces to the main
characteristics of the products like type of shut-off, installation
depth, standards, etc, once it has been stored or installed. The
disc is yellow for single-shut off version, and blue for the double
shut-off version.
